Why a simple Kindergarten project can mess with your self-esteem...

So the girls brought home a project their first week of kindergarten. The instructions were to cut out the "little person" provided and have your child make it look like themselves. So I gave the girls a box of crayons and let them "create". Besides, I had a fussy baby and a screaming three year old who needed my attention at that moment so I thought nothing more of this easy project.

Fast forward 9 weeks and I am standing out both of the girls classrooms (they adjoin) and the sweet little people are glued to the bulletin board in the hallway for everyone to see. And I find the girls "girls" and then they start pointing out their friends "people". And that is when I noticed that alot of these projects had yarn for hair, glitter for shoes, real buttons, real clothes, etc. And the Tidwell girls just had crayon. Talk about a sinking feeling. I realized I should have helped the girls a little more. But I didn't even think to get out real fabric, real buttons, yarn for hair, refurbished Barbie clothes, etc. I thought that the child was supposed to do the project...guess not!!
